Outlook 

Week 4 offers us a 12-game slate with some potential strong leverage in late swap if we don’t get news on Deebo Samuel (currently questionable) before the 1:00 PM kickoffs. We should also expect to see about 40% of rosters building around either Kyler Murray or Jayden Daniels and we’ll discuss how we can leverage that knowledge below. 

Important Early Outcomes to Watch:
  • Diontae Johnson – The Panthers WR is likely to carry the highest overall ownership on the slate coming off the second-best game of his career with Andy Dalton now at the helm for Carolina.     
  • Nico Collins – The Texans star wideout is expected to see an increased role with Tank Dell inactive. Squaring off against a Jaguars secondary that has allowed multiple 100 yards receiving games already this season, Collins is projected for around 25% ownership. 
  • Dallas Goedert & Saquon Barkley – With both AJ Brown and DeVonta Smith inactive, the Eagles offense is likely to funnel almost exclusively through these two, and their projected ownership reflects this belief.
